Black Rock State Park is a stunning natural oasis in Connecticut, perfect for outdoor enthusiasts and families alike. With breathtaking views, diverse wildlife, and numerous recreational activities, it’s a must-visit destination for tourists seeking adventure and relaxation in nature.

Local tips
- Arrive early to secure a good parking spot, especially on weekends.
- Bring plenty of water and snacks to keep your energy up during hikes.
- Check the weather before your visit to ensure a pleasant outdoor experience.
- Wear sturdy footwear for hiking and exploring the rocky areas.
- Keep an eye on children near cliff edges; safety first!
